Tablet coating is often a process in pharmaceutical production where a protecting layer is placed on a tablet's floor to improve drug balance, mask unpleasant tastes, Regulate drug release, or enrich appearance. Sorts of coatings include sugar coating, which will involve multiple layers of sugar but is time-consuming and will increase pill sizing; film coating, a thin polymer layer presenting longevity and Manage about drug release; enteric coating, which guards drugs from abdomen acid and dissolves from the intestines; compression coating, ideal for humidity-sensitive drugs; and gelatin coating, employed for soft gels and capsules.

A drug delivery system (DDS) is described for a formulation or a tool that enables the introduction of a therapeutic substance in the human body and improves its efficacy and protection by controlling the rate, time, and put of release of drugs in the body. This method contains the administration from the therapeutic product or service, the release of the Lively elements via the merchandise, and the subsequent transportation of the Lively substances over the biological membranes to the positioning of action. The expression therapeutic material also relates to an agent for example gene therapy that may induce in vivo production of the Lively therapeutic agent. Drug delivery system can be an interface in between the affected individual and the drug. It might be a formulation with the drug to administer it for your therapeutic reason or a device applied to provide the drug. This difference amongst the drug plus the device is vital, as it's the criterion for regulatory Charge of the delivery system with the drug or medication Manage company.

Prolonged-release tablets are much like sustained-release tablets, but they are meant to release the read more drug more bit by bit above a far more extended time period. This brings about a more gradual boost in the drug concentration during the bloodstream, with the utmost focus getting lessen than that reached by instant-release or sustained-release tablets.
